ARM64 support > does not allow mach-* directories at all. While we may not get to that > given all the non-standard architectures we support, we should still try > to get as close as we can and reduce the number of mach directories. > > The mach-airoha/ directory, and files within, provide just one "feature": > having the kernel print the machine name if the DTB does not also contain > a "model" string (which they always do). To reduce the number of mach-* > directories let's do without that feature and remove this directory. I'm guessing this is copy-n-pasted description. However: > -static const char * const airoha_board_dt_compat[] = { > - "airoha,en7523", > - NULL, > -}; > - > -DT_MACHINE_START(MEDIATEK_DT, "Airoha Cortex-A53 (Device Tree)") > - .dt_compat = airoha_board_dt_compat, > -MACHINE_END If this is actually used, then it will have the effect of providing a "machine" that has both l2c_aux_mask and l2c_aux_val as zero, whereas the default one has l2c_aux_mask set to ~0. This has the effect of _not_ calling l2x0_of_init() - but you don't mention this.
